Our extension is nearly finished and the builders ard now building our deck flush with the internal floor and upto the bifolds. The deck goes up to the garden wall and I think will be 30cm above ground level at its highest - mostly it will be a bit less than this. The deck was on the plans we submitted for planning permission, although the height wasn't specified. The garden wall is not that high and we do now overlook our next door neighbour. I have told him that we will be putting up trellis all the way along the wall, which should help on the privacy front.
However, I am concerned that he might object and am not sure if he has grounds to or not??Our relationship is not that great at the moment due to our lengthy building works. We also have a higher deck in the bottom corner if our garden for which I think we did required planning permission, but were unaware of at the time. It was built 3 years ago and no one has objected.
Our neighbours architectural technologist is coming to see him on Monday and is a former planning officer - should I be worried? Thanks
